On average across the year,
yes, Tuvalu is hotter than
New Brunswick, Canada
.
Tuvalu has an average temperature of 29°C/84°F and New Brunswick, Canada has an average temperature of 6°C/43°F.
Tuvalu's hottest month is January,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than New Brunswick, Canada's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 25°C/77°F).
On average across the year, no, Tuvalu is not colder than New Brunswick, Canada . Tuvalu has an average minimum temperature of 26°C/79°F and New Brunswick, Canada has an average minimum temperature of 1°C/34°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Tuvalu has more rain than
New Brunswick, Canada. Tuvalu has an average annual rainfall of 1453mm and New Brunswick, Canada has an average annual rainfall of 973mm.
Tuvalu's wettest month is March, with an average monthly rainfall of 177mm, which is wetter than New Brunswick, Canada's wettest month (December, with an average monthly rainfall of 105mm).
